CAS 646477-45-4
:3-aminotropane dihydrochloride
Description:
3-Aminotropane dihydrochloride is a chemical compound characterized by its structure, which includes a tropane ring with an amino group at the 3-position. This compound is typically encountered as a dihydrochloride salt, which enhances its solubility in water and makes it suitable for various applications in research and pharmaceuticals. The presence of the amino group contributes to its basicity and potential reactivity, allowing it to participate in various chemical reactions, including those involving nucleophilic substitution. As a dihydrochloride, it is often used in biological studies and may exhibit pharmacological properties, although specific biological activities can vary. The compound is usually handled with care in laboratory settings due to its potential effects on biological systems. Proper storage conditions are essential to maintain its stability, and it should be kept in a cool, dry place, away from light. As with many chemical substances, safety precautions should be observed when handling 3-aminotropane dihydrochloride to minimize exposure and ensure safe usage.
Formula:C8H18Cl2N2
InChI:InChI=1/C8H16N2.2ClH/c1-10-7-2-3-8(10)5-6(9)4-7;;/h6-8H,2-5,9H2,1H3;2*1H
SMILES:CN1C2CCC1CC(C2)N.Cl.Cl
Synonyms:- 8-Methyl-8-Aza-Bicyclo[3.2.1]Octan-3-Amine Dihydrochloride
- 3-Ammonio-8-Methyl-8-Azoniabicyclo[3.2.1]Octane Dichloride
- 8-Methyl-8-azabicyclo[3.2.1]octan-3-amine dihydrochloride
